What happened

Nvidia CEO Jensen Huang addressed criticisms of DLSS 5, clarifying its function as "content-controlled generative AI" rather than a general-purpose model or a post-processing filter. Huang stated DLSS 5 enhances game geometry without altering it, maintaining artistic intent. He also revealed future capabilities allowing artists to prompt the system for specific stylistic generation, such as "toon shader" effects, consistent with their vision. This follows earlier GTC 2026 comments where Huang dismissed similar concerns.

Why it matters

Game developers and graphics architects gain a new tool for stylistic control within the rendering pipeline. DLSS 5's "content-controlled generative AI" mechanism offers direct artistic influence over visual output, enabling style generation via prompting without altering core geometry. This shifts the interaction model for integrating AI-driven enhancements, reducing post-production cycles for specific visual effects.
